Data and supplemental figures for manuscript titled "Net release and uptake of xenometabolites across intestinal, hepatic, muscle, and renal tissue beds in healthy conscious pigs." We used a catheterized conscious pig model to estimate inter-organ flux of xenometabolites, derivatives, and bile acids using LC/MS. Female pigs (n=12; 2-3 months old; 25.6 ± 2.2 kg) had surgically-implanted catheters across portal-drained viscera (PDV), splanchnic area (SPL), liver, kidney, and hindquarter muscle. Overnight fasted arterial and venous plasma was collected simultaneously in a conscious state and stored at -80°C. Thawed samples were analyzed by liquid chromatography-mass spectrometry. Plasma flow was determined with para-aminohippuric acid dilution technology and used to calculate net organ balance for each metabolite.
